Purple features a rich and fascinating history that dates back again thousands of yrs. In ancient times, the color purple was unbelievably unusual and high-priced to generate, rendering it a image of wealth and royalty. The Phoenicians ended up the main to make purple dye in the mucus of sea snails, a approach that was labor-intensive and time-consuming. This made purple material amazingly worthwhile and only available to the elite. In actual fact, in historical Rome, only the emperor was permitted to wear a purple toga, and any one else caught wearing the color can be place to Demise. This Affiliation with royalty and energy ongoing all through background, with purple getting the colour of option for monarchs and rulers. It wasn't till the nineteenth century that synthetic dyes have been created, making purple far more obtainable to the general inhabitants.

The background of purple is additionally deeply intertwined with religion and spirituality. In lots of cultures, purple is associated with spirituality and enlightenment. In Christianity, purple is the colour of Lent and Arrival, symbolizing penance and preparing. In Hinduism, purple is related to the crown chakra, symbolizing knowledge and spiritual expansion. The color's wealthy background and cultural importance have produced it a timeless image of luxury, electric power, and spirituality.

Enjoyment Specifics About Purple


- The word "purple" emanates from the Outdated English phrase "purpul," which was derived in the Latin term "purpura," this means "purple fish."
- In historic Rome, just the emperor was permitted to use purple outfits.
- The very first synthetic dye for purple was established in 1856 by 18-calendar year-old William Henry Perkin.
- The colour purple is commonly connected with royalty due to its rarity and cost in historic times.
- Purple is commonly used in advertising and marketing to evoke thoughts of luxury and sophistication.
- The city of Tyre in Phoenicia was recognized for its creation of purple dye from sea snails.
- In Japan, purple is frequently linked to prosperity and place.
- The Purple Coronary heart medal is awarded by the United States navy for functions of bravery or sacrifice.
- The main recorded use of the color "purple" being a term in English was in 975 Advert.
- The colour purple is often connected with creativity and individuality.
